Amazing Sandunes and Beaches

Just returned from a week at this lovely site. It is very well laid out with spacious grass pitches. The wardens are all very friendly and helpful. The site is located across the road from the sandunes which are fab for walking the dog (just watch for the cliff edge!!). Continue past these to the beautiful Gwithian Towans beach which is great for surfing/bodyboarding. This beach then links to several others on a stretch of maybe 2-3 miles of glorious sandy beaches going towards to Hayle Estuary. Behind the car park at Gwithian Towans is a lovely cafe ‘Sunset Surf’. Well worth a visit for breakfast (opens at 10am). A visit to St Ives is a must.....beautiful!!
